About the Item

A rare Swedish Art Deco napkin holder from the 1930s, beautifully cast in bronze, featuring a stylized nude female dancer in a dramatic, arched pose. The figure is mounted against a semicircular bronze backdrop, enhancing the sculptural silhouette and creating a refined sense of movement. This piece is a fine example of Scandinavian Art Deco, where functionality and form go hand in hand. Likely produced in Sweden during the interwar period, the napkin holder combines elegance, craftsmanship, and artistic flair — turning an everyday object into a decorative sculpture.
